3D Printing in Oral Surgery
To improve the area of oral surgery, you can explore the subtopic of 3D printing in dental surgery. This ingenious modern technology has the prospective to reinvent the means oral specialists operate and treat individuals. Right here are four key ways in which 3D printing is shaping the area:
- ** Customized Surgical Guides **: 3D printing allows for the development of extremely accurate and patient-specific surgical overviews, improving the precision and performance of procedures.
- ** Implant Prosthetics **: With 3D printing, dental specialists can produce personalized implant prosthetics that completely fit a person's special composition, causing much better end results and individual satisfaction.
- ** Bone Grafting **: 3D printing enables the production of patient-specific bone grafts, lowering the requirement for conventional grafting techniques and enhancing healing and recuperation time.
- ** Education and learning and Training **: 3D printing can be used to create realistic medical versions for educational purposes, enabling dental cosmetic surgeons to exercise complex treatments prior to doing them on clients.
With its possible to enhance accuracy, personalization, and training, 3D printing is an exciting advancement in the field of oral surgery.
